Porcine circovirus type 3 (PCV3) shedding in sow colostrum

Veterinary Microbiology, 2018
The major objective of this work was to investigate the shedding of porcine circovirus type 3 (PCV3) in sow colostrum. PCV3 titers in the serum and colostrum samples of 38 sows were determined using qPCR. Interestingly, this is the first report regarding the identification of PCV3 from the colostrum samples.
